EQQJ523E A VALIDATION PATTERN IS REQUIRED FOR PICT VERIFICATION
Explanation: Because you asked for PICT verification, you must enter a validation pattern.
System action: The system waits for you to respond.
User response: Enter the correct value.
EQQJ524E Y/N MUST BE ENTERED IN NUMERIC FIELD FOR LIST/RANGE
Explanation: Because you asked for RANGE verification, you must enter Y (yes) or N (no) in the numeric field.
System action: The system waits for you to respond.
User response: Enter the correct value.
EQQJ525E THE JCL VARIABLE TABLE HAS BEEN DELETED
Explanation: The current variable table has been deleted from TME 10 OPC’s database.
System action: The table is deleted.
User response: None.

EQQJ527E THE VALUES/RANGES MAY NOT CONTAIN IMBEDDED BLANKS
Explanation: You cannot use blanks in a LIST/RANGE verification value list.
System action: The system waits for you to respond.
User response: Enter the correct value.
EQQJ528E THE NUMBER OF VALUES MUST BE EVEN FOR RANGE VERIFICATION
Explanation: You specified an odd number of values for a range verification.
System action: The system waits for you to respond.
User response: Enter the correct value.
EQQJ529E THE VALUES DEFINING A RANGE ARE IN DESCENDING SEQUENCE
Explanation: You entered a range that consists of a larger number followed by a smaller number. You must specify
the smaller number (beginning of the range) before the larger number (end of the range).
System action: The system waits for you to respond.
User response: Enter the correct value.
EQQJ530E SCANNING LENGTH EXCEEDED LINE
LINE
OF
SCTN
Explanation: Substitution of a JCL command has caused the command length to exceed 71 characters, or
substitution of an in-stream data line has caused the in-stream data line to exceed 80 characters.
System action: If the error occurs during submit, the current operation status is set to ended-in-error with error code
OJCV. Otherwise, the status is not changed.
System programmer response: If the substitution is correct, split the command line over two or more lines. If the
problem occurs in an in-stream data line, verify that the ISPF profile option for sequence numbering is turned off in the
JCL job library.
